GhostMyData is a privacy protection platform that scans 1,500+ data broker sites to find your exposed personal information. We automatically submit legal CCPA and state privacy law deletion requests on your behalf, verify each removal, and continuously monitor for re-listings.

Key features: - 1,500+ data broker coverage (3.5x more than Incogni, 17x more than DeleteMe's auto-removal) - Legal CCPA deletion requests, not just opt-out forms - Automated re-removal when brokers re-list your data - Family plans protect up to 5 household members - Live broker compliance report showing which brokers actually delete - Free scan with 3 free trial removals โ€” no credit card required

Plans start at $9.99/month billed annually.

What's the story behind your product?

GhostMyData's answer:

I discovered my full name, home address, phone numbers, and family members' details were publicly listed on hundreds of people-search sites โ€” available to anyone for under a dollar. After spending 40+ hours manually submitting opt-out forms, I realized the data just comes back. So I built GhostMyData to automate the entire process.

Which are the primary technologies used for building your product?

GhostMyData's answer:

Next.js, React, TypeScript, Prisma ORM, PostgreSQL, Vercel, Resend for transactional email, Amazon SES for broker CCPA emails, Google and Brave Search APIs for exposure detection.
